Disabled achievers take to the ramp to promote inclusive marriages

Get-hooked December 8, 2017
  • Click to share on Twitter (Opens in new window)
  • Click to share on Facebook (Opens in new window)
  • Click to share on LinkedIn (Opens in new window)
  • Click to share on WhatsApp (Opens in new window)

Many couples walked the fashion ramp in Chennai to promote inclusive marriages as part of the International Day of Persons with Disabilities.

Like Shalini, a fashion designer, who is married to disabled entrepreneur Visakan Rajendiran. Dressed in her best, she moved his wheelchair as both waved at the audience.

Rajendiran said that the disabled men are eligible bachelors like anybody else and deserved good-looking partners and should not compromise on this due to their disability.

Another participant, Poongothai said it was his disabled partner who proposed to him.

The event was organised by the Headway Foundation as part of its first year anniversary. Achievers included Justin Vijay Jesudas, national Paralympic swimming champion; Sathyamoorthy, international wheelchair tennis player; Meenakshi, a rights activist, and Shams Alaam, Mr India Wheelchair 2017 and paraplegic world record holder in open sea swimming.
